Is a windbreaker a rain jacket?
A rain jacket is, as the name suggests, primarily intended for protection against the rain, but it also provides good protection against the wind. Windbreakers, on the other hand, provide very little protection against the rain, but efficiently block the wind.
Does a windbreaker work as a rain jacket?
Windbreakers are lightweight, breathable and offer a thin layer of protection from the elements. And while they might offer some protection against a light, brief rain, they are typically not fully waterproof and won’t withstand an average shower.

What is the best material for a windbreaker?
Polyester. It is quite akin to micro polyester and is noiseless as compared to nylon, although it is a little bulky in size. Polyester windbreakers are also usually designed with a mesh or cotton lining. Those designed with cotton lining are warmer in nature.

Why do windbreakers make you sweat?
When the air is humid it has a lot of water vapor in it. If the external surface of your rain jacket is cooler than its interior, the water vapor will condense on the inside your jacket and make your clothes wet. Perspiration also produces water vapor and condenses by the same process.
